Nigeria Govt Expels American Missionary For Allegedly Inciting Violence, Division

  LAGOS APRIL 8TH (NEWSRANGERS)-The Nigerian government has expelled controversial American missionary Alex Barbir from the country, accusing him of making statements capable of inciting violence and deepening divisions, particularly in Plateau State. Barbir, a former American college football player turned humanitarian, gained attention for his work in Nigeria’s North-Central region, including rebuilding homes, drilling…

Plateau: 36 Cows Die, 42 Others Critically Ill After Consumption Of ‘Poisoned Garden Eggs’

LAGOS APRIL 18TH (NEWSRANGERS)-Thirty six cows were reportedly killed while 42 others were left critically ill after suspected poisoning in the Tafi Gana junction area of Bassa Local Government Area of Plateau State on Wednesday. The Chairman of the Miyetti Allah Cattle Breeders Association of Nigeria (MACBAN) in Bassa LGA, Ya’u Idris, confirmed the incident,…
